Background
-
AKAP8L could play a role in constitutive transport element (CTE)-mediated gene expression. It does not seem to be implicated in the binding of regulatory subunit II of PKA. It may be involved in nuclear envelope breakdown and chromatin condensation. It may regulate the initiation phase of DNA replication when associated with TMPO-beta.
